Ancient Fenghuang, a village in central China, used to be a frontier town, separating the Han civilization from the Miao and Dong minorities. It was an important regional center for trade and cultural exchange.

The riverside setting of the village, with its wooden stilt houses and narrow mysterious back alleys, makes it one of the most attractive places in the region.

These days, it has become a major tourist destination. While some traditions remain, much of the town has been set up to cater for the influx of new visitors, in some ways changing the face of the village beyond recognition.

Either way, Fenghuang provides an interesting glimpse of the many challenges and contrasts that exist in China today.

Fenghuang Ancient Town, aka Phoenix Ancient Town and Feng Huang Gu Cheng in Chinese, is situated on the western boundary of Hunan Province in an area of outstanding natural beauty where mountains, water and blue skies prevail. 'Fenghuang' is Chinese for 'Phoenix', the mythical bird of good omen and longevity that is consumed by fire to be re-born again from the flames.

Fenghuang Ancient Town is so called as legend has it that two of these fabulous birds flew over it and found the Fenghuang Town so beautiful that they hovered there, reluctant to leave.

Fenghuang Ancient City, also know as Phoenix Ancient Town, is located in Xiangxi Tujia and Miao Autonomous Prefecture, in southwest of Hunan Province.

It is one of the smaller counties in Hunan, but now it is known as the most beautiful ancient town for its long history and well-preserved appearances. The name of Phoenix (Phoenix in Chinese Pinyin is Fenghuang) town mainly derived from the Phoenix Mountain which is in a phoenix shape.
------------------------------
★★ Fenghuang Old Town ★★
------------------------------
Fenghuang Ancient City has basically maintained the layout and original appearances of the Ming and Qing dynasties to this day.

There preserved in the ancient town zone over 200 ancient residential buildings, some 20 large or small streets, 10 ancient lanes and alleys, as well as ancient town walls, ancient town gate towers, ancient leaping rock, ancient wells, ancient rainbow bridges, ancient temples of literature, ancient temples of poems, ancient ancestral temples etc., all of which are by and large preserved in their original state.

The residential environment featuring harmony between human and the mountains, waters and the town has been preserved in its original form up to now.

★★ Main Attractions and interesting things to do:
------------------------------
★★ Tuojiang River:
Tuojiang River is the mother river of the ancient town of Fenghuang, getting on the local black-awning boat (pronounced Wupeng Boat in Chinese), enjoying the folk songs sung by the helmsman, watching the featured Diaojiao buildings all along the river bank, boating downstream and crossing the Rainbow bridge, all make guest feel like touring in a scroll painting.

★★ Gate towers:
Four ancient city gates exist in the town, the East Gate Tower was built by red sand rocks and it is of the same importance as the North Gate Tower, the gates protected the town a lot in ancient time.

★★ Former residences:
People started to know the Phoenix Town from one famous Chinese writer – Shen Congwen. Mr. Shen was born here in a classic ancient quadrangle courtyard at Fenghuang town. Except from the Former Residence of Shen Congwen, visitors may also look around the Xiong Xiling’s Former Residence, Mr. Xiong Xiling was called ‘the wonder child of Hunan province’ and he was elected as the first elected Prime Minister of the Republican period in 1913.

★★ Ancestral hall:
The Ancestral Hall of Yang Family was built in 1836 and located in the northeast of the ancient city wall of Fenghuang, people may marvel at the fantastic designing and work of the hall.

★★ Hongqiao Wind and Rain Bridge:
The bridge has three arches, the height from the river surface to the top of the bridge compares a couple of floors. Mr. Huang Yongyu’s (born in Fenghuang and famous for his print making) left his antithetical couplet on the bridge and left the world with imagination and wonders. The second floor of the bridge is used for receiving importance guests and exhibiting calligraphies and paintings.

Fenghuang County (simplified Chinese: 凤凰县; traditional Chinese: 鳳凰縣; pinyin: Fènghuáng Xiàn; literally: phoenix county) is under the administration of Xiangxi Tujia and Miao Autonomous Prefecture, Hunan province, China, bordering the prefecture-level cities of Huaihua to the southeast and Tongren (Guizhou) to the west. It has an exceptionally well-preserved ancient town that harbors unique ethnic languages, customs, arts as well as many distinctive architectural remains of Ming and Qing styles. The town is placed in a mountain setting, incorporating the natural flow of water into city layout. Over half of the city's population belong to the Miao or Tujia minorities. It was the centre of the unsuccessful Miao Rebellion (1854–73), which created a Miao diaspora in Southeast Asia during the last two centuries. The city is revered in Miao traditions and funeral rites and is the location of the Southern China Great Wall (中国南方长城; 中國南方長城; Zhōngguó Nánfāng Chángchéng; Miao: Suav Tuam Choj), a fortification built by the Ming dynasty to protect the local Han Chinese from Miao attacks. Formerly known as Wang Village, Furong Ancient Town has a history of more than 2,000 years. It is called the Ancient Town Hanging on the Waterfall because of the magnificent waterfall passing through the town. The movie Hibiscus Town, starring well-known actress Liu Xiaoqing and actor Jiang Wen, was shot here.

Furong Ancient Town is not only a place with a long history, but also a tourist resort that combines natural scenery with primitive ethnic customs. Surrounded by green mountains and clear water, the town is full of winding alleys, the Tujia stilted wooden houses, and streets paved with flagstones, which reflect simple folk customs of the local Tujia people.

Furong Waterfall:
--------------------------
the waterfall is the premier natural beauty and a must-see in Furong Ancient Town. Furong town is surrounded by water on three sides, the magnificent waterfall passes through the town. This is the largest and most spectacular waterfall in western Hunan province, with a height of 60 meters and a width of 40 meters. The two levels of water pour down from cliff, and the momentum is quite huge.

The two-thousand-year old ancient town is also an attraction that integrates natural scenery with primitive simplicity. In addition, it is the portal to the Mengdong River Scenic Area, a charming place of karst landforms.

As is described in the novel ‘Furong Town’, by Chen Yunhe, the pack basket is swinging on the back of the girl who speaks a Xiangxi dialect, and the life in the Mengdong River Scenic Area has many tales to tell. Located deeply in the mountains and waters, zigzag lanes can be even found in the downtown area.

Houses built on stilts are on the waterside. Green flagstones pave the five-mile street. Tourists find the place unforgettable.

At the entrance of the waterfall, there is a rock cave – the relic site of early Tujia people who arrived here to escape the war. Though the cave is now much eroded by water, visitors are still amazed by how big the cave was to hold thousands of people back then.
-------------------------------
WHO ARE THE TUJIA?
-------------------------------
The Tujia, China’s eighth largest ethnic minority, is a group consisting of around 8 million people. They can be found in Hunan as well as neighboring provinces like Hubei and Guizhou.

Fenghuang County (simplified Chinese: 凤凰县; traditional Chinese: 鳳凰縣; pinyin: Fènghuáng Xiàn), named after the mythological birds Fenghuang, is a county of Hunan Province, China, under the administration of Xiangxi Autonomous Prefecture.

Located on the western margin of the province and the southern Xiangxi, it is immediately adjacent to the eastern edge of Guizhou Province. The county is bordered to the north by Huayuan County and Jishou City, to the east by Luxi County, to the southeast by Mayang County, to the southwest and the west by Bijiang District of Tongren City and Songtao County of Guizhou. Fenghuang County covers 1,745 km2 (674 sq mi), as of 2015, It had a registered population of 428,294 and a resident population of 363,700.The county has 13 towns and four townships under its jurisdiction, the county seat is Tuojiang

Fenghuang: An Ancient Chinese City Destroyed by Tourism

Read more at Fenghuang is a county in western Hunan province of China that was a virtual backwater up until 2001 when the management rights of ten tourist sites -- including the old city of Fenghuang -- were purchased by the Yellow Dragon Cave Corporation. They have since turned the place into the epitome of unchecked tourism exploitation, extracting most of the profits out of the area. Whether this good or bad is debatable, this video just intends to show just how rampant tourism has become there.
